Definition

A cured and smoked product made from ground or sliced turkey, designed as a leaner alternative to traditional pork bacon, with a similar savory, smoky flavor.

Cooking Tip

Cook until crisp; can be prone to drying out if overcooked

Fat Content

Typically 70-80% less fat than traditional pork bacon

Primary Use

Breakfast side, BLTs, crumbled in salads, ingredient in wraps

Chef’s Secret

For extra crispy turkey bacon, cook it slowly over medium-low heat to render out the fat and prevent burning before it crisps.

Substitutions

Best Match

Beef Bacon

1:1

Offers a similar lean, cured, and smoky profile, often with a slightly richer flavor.

Pork Bacon (lean cut)

1:1

The original, more fatty but can be cooked crisply for similar applications.

Smoked Ham (thinly sliced)

1:1

Provides salty, smoky flavor but lacks the characteristic crispy texture.

Mushroom Bacon (e.g., shiitake)

1:1

Vegan alternative providing umami and a chewy/crispy texture, but different flavor.
